Title: The Innovative Mind of Jonathan Jay Feinstein
Introduction: Jonathan Jay Feinstein, a prolific inventor hailing from North Salem, NY, has made a significant mark in the world of patents with a total of 18 patents under his belt.
Latest Patents:
1. Ammonia production method: Jonathan's groundbreaking method involves the production of high purity hydrogen through a steam reforming hydrogen production unit, enhancing efficiency and reducing power requirements in the process.
2. Support structure for structured catalyst packings: He devised a support structure that optimizes the performance of structured catalytic packings within a reactor tube, showcasing his ingenuity in catalytic technologies.
Career Highlights: With a focus on innovation and efficiency, Jonathan has demonstrated expertise in areas such as hydrogen production, catalytic technologies, and chemical processes. His patents reflect a deep understanding of complex systems and a drive for sustainable solutions.
Collaborations: Jonathan has collaborated with visionaries like Lanier Stambaugh and Ian F Masterson during his tenure at Zoneflow Reactor Technologies, LLC. This collaborative spirit has led to the development of cutting-edge technologies and solutions in the industry.
